Description : Near Eastern Ceramic Tell el Yahudiyeh Ware Burnished Jug 1750-1650 BC. A mammiform slipware jug with discoid base, deep shoulder, narrow neck, everted rim and double strap handle. UK art market, acquired prior to 1980. 'Tell el-Yahudiyeh Ware' is a ceramic type of the late Middle Bronze Age (Second Intermediate Period) which derives its name from the site at Tell el-Yahudiyeh in the eastern Nile Delta of Egypt, ancient Neytahut or Leontoplis. 735 grams, 21 cm (8 1/4).
